21xrx.com
2024-12-27 17:09:34 Friday
登录
文章检索 我的文章 写文章
C++编程:小写字母转大写字母
2023-07-10 22:54:37 深夜i     --     --
C++语言 小写字母 大写字母 转换 编程技巧

C++编程是一项伟大的技能,可以让开发人员创建各种软件和应用程序。其中一个常见的编程问题是将小写字母转换为大写字母。这对于许多应用程序非常重要,例如电子邮件客户端和文本编辑器。以下是使用C++编写的有关如何将小写字母转换为大写字母的示例代码。

在开始编写代码之前,我们需要了解C++中与字符相关的一些常用方法和函数。其中一些方法和函数是:

- toupper():将小写字母转换为大写字母

- islower():检查一个字符是否是小写字母

现在,我们将使用这些函数来编写程序。

首先,我们需要创建一个字符变量,用于存储要转换的小写字母。然后,我们使用islower()函数检查该字符是否是小写字母。如果是,我们使用toupper()函数将其转换为大写字母,并打印出结果。如果不是小写字母,则打印错误消息。下面是完整的示例代码:

#include

#include //toupper() and islower() functions are defined in this header file

using namespace std;

int main()

{

  char lowerLetter;

  cout << "Enter a lowercase letter to convert to uppercase: ";

  cin >> lowerLetter;

  if(islower(lowerLetter))

  {

    cout << "Uppercase version: " << (char)toupper(lowerLetter) << endl;

  }

  else

    cout << "Error: not a lowercase letter." << endl;

  return 0;

}

在这个程序中,我们使用了命名空间std来访问标准C++库中的函数和方法。还使用了包含头文件 ,以便使用toupper()和islower()函数。

在程序运行时,我们将提示用户输入一个小写字母。然后,程序将检查该字符是否是小写字母。如果是,它将使用toupper()函数将其转换为大写字母。如果不是,则打印错误消息。最后,程序将在屏幕上打印结果。

总的来说,使用C++编写字符转换程序是非常简单和有用的。通过使用一个组合的方法和函数,我们可以轻松地将小写字母转换为大写字母,并让我们的应用程序更加实用和灵活。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复